Where do I wear the Trained patch? For shirts with pocket sleeves, the emblem is worn on the left sleeve pocket flap above the badge of office. For shirts without pocket sleeves, the emblem is worn on the left sleeve immediately below and touching the emblem of office for which it was earned.
Can you put merit badges on the back of the sash?
Merit badge sashes are worn only by Scouts, Sea Scouts, or Venturers who are earning Scout advancement. Merit badges may be worn on the front and back of the sash. Temporary patches may only be worn on the back of the sash. The merit badge sash and the Order of the Arrow sash may not be worn at the same time.

Where does the whittling chip patch go on a Cub Scout uniform?
The Official BSA Whittling Chip for Cub Scouts and Webelos Scouts is a Wallet Card (No. 34223A) and/or Patch (08598). The patch is considered a 'temporary' patch and should only be displayed on the uniform sewn centered on the right pocket, or hung in a temporary patch holder from the pocket button.

The Firem'n Chit patch can be worn as a temporary patch and, if worn, should be worn centered on the RIGHT pocket of the Scout uniform, NOT on the pocket flap. If desired, it is acceptable to place the Firem'n Chit patch on the back of the sash. Building a campfire is a crucial skill for scouting.

What is a parent pin for Cub Scouts?
Parent pins are small metal pins that replicate the rank award that Cub Scouts earn. Some Packs choose to purchase these pins and present them to the parent of a Cub Scout during their Cub’s rank presentation ceremony. According to the BSA’s Guide to Awards and Insignia, parent pins are not for uniform wear. I have seen (mostly) the mothers of many Scouts display their parent pins on the BSA Proud Parent Ribbon (BSA item 643292), available at: BSA Proud Parent ribbon (scoutshop.org)
What shirt do Webelos wear?
Webelos and Arrows of Light wear the tan uniform shirt like Boy Scouts. When the Scouts earn their Webelos rank, they will wear the badge sewn onto the left pocket. The Arrow of Light rank patch goes directly below the left pocket. It is the only Cub Scout badge that may be worn on the Boy Scout uniform.

What is the Order of the Arrow Lodge flap?
The Order of the Arrow Lodge flap identifies Scouts who are apart of an Order of the Arrow Lodge. These patches are worn directly on the right pocket flap and are the only approved patch to be worn in this location.
What do the shoulder loops on a scout's shoulder mean?
Lets start with Shoulder Loops! These indicate the branch of Scouting your currently in. Shoulder Loops slide easily on the Shoulder Strap. There are 5 different colored Shoulder Loops to represent the different programs and positions you can hold in the BSA! Blue for Cub Scout, Olive for Scouts BSA, Blaze for Varsity Scouts, Green for Venturer, Silver for District and Council, and Gold for Regional and National! You may be in multiple programs and have multiple uniforms and Shoulder Loops. You should wear the Shoulder Loop that matches whichever role you’re preforming that day!

Where is the World Crest emblem on a uniform?
World Crest Emblem and World Crest Ring:The World Crest Emblem is required for all uniforms and is worn above the left pocket. The World Crest Ring is optional but very common; the Ring is worn around the World Crest emblem above the left pocket between the left shoulder seam and the top of the left pocket, or 3/8” above the pocket seam.
